68
•
Motion Library
@ Syntax
C/C++ (DOS, Windows 95/98/NT/2000)
I16 _8136_R_Set_RIO_Clk(I16 CardNo, I16 SlaveNo, I16
Clk_Divider)
I16 _8136_A_Set_DAC_Clk(I16 CardNo, I16 Clk_Divider)
I16 _8136_A_Set_ADC_Clk(I16 CardNo, I16 Clk_Divider)
I16 _8136_S_Set_Timer_Value(I16 CardNo,U32 TimerValue)
I16 _8136_P_Set_Enc_Filter(I16 CardNo,I16 Filter)
Visual Basic 5.0 or higher
B_8136_R_Set_RIO_Clk(ByVal CardNo As Integer, ByVal
SlaveNo As Integer, ByVal Clk_Divider As Integer) As Integer
B_8136_A_Set_DAC_Clk(ByVal CardNo As Integer, ByVal
Clk_Divider As Integer) As Integer
B_8136_A_Set_ADC_Clk(ByVal CardNo As Integer, ByVal
Clk_Divider As Integer ) As Integer
B_8136_S_Set_Timer_Value(ByVal CardNo As Integer , ByVal
TimerValue As Long ) As Integer
B_8136_P_Set_Enc_Filte r(ByVal CardNo As Integer, ByVal Filter
As Integer) As Integer
@ Arguments
CardNo: card number designated to set (Range 0 ~ 3)
SlaveNo: Select which slave would be set ( Range 0~1)
Clk_Divider: Set transmission clock divider ( Range 0~127 )
TimerValue: Set timer value (Range28-Bits)
Filter: Set Filter sample clock divider (Range 0~127)
@ Return Code
ERR_RangeError
ERR_NoError
Summary of Contents for PCI-8136M
Page 1: ...PCI 8136M 6 Axis Motion Controller Card User s Guide ...
Page 2: ......